Members Only Jacket Key To Sopranos Finale?

A man in a Members Only jacket sits at the counter of the diner where Tony Soprano and his family have dinner. It's the very last scene of The Sopranos, and the stranger's presence is one of many theories that has developed from the show's controversial ending. In an attempt to shed some more light on this matter, we investigated the famous piece of outerware in earlier, more innocent times with General Hospital star Anthony Geary. Did Tony get whacked or not? Well, according to Members Only, "When You Put It On...Something Happens."
